About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Own and independently negotiate a broad range of commercial agreements, including enterprise customer agreements, SaaS agreements, marketplace and channel partnerships, retail and fulfillment arrangements, vendor agreements, data protection agreements, professional services agreements, marketing agreements and other strategic transactions.
  • Provide timely, practical and business-oriented legal advice to Sales, Partnerships, Product, Operations, Finance, Marketing, People and other internal stakeholders.
  • Serve as a primary legal partner for strategic and revenue-generating initiatives, helping teams’ structure new products, partnerships, programs and go-to-market models in a scalable and compliant manner.
  • Lead legal support for enterprise deals and customer diligence, including privacy, security, compliance, insurance and product-related questions.
  • Draft, maintain and improve standard agreements, fallback positions, negotiation playbooks, approval frameworks and self-service resources.
  • Develop and improve contracting and legal intake processes to reduce friction, accelerate deal cycles and create better visibility into legal work and contractual commitments.
  • Partner with Product teams on data protection, AI, product counseling and regulatory issues, including the review of new tools, data uses and customer-facing functionality.
  • Support corporate, employment and general legal matters as needed, including policy development, dispute management, compliance initiatives and coordination with outside counsel.
  • Monitor relevant legal and regulatory developments and translate them into practical guidance for the business.
  • Help build a strong legal function by sharing knowledge, documenting processes and supporting cross-functional training.

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• J.D. from an accredited law school and active membership in good standing in at least one U.S. state bar.
  • Approximately 6+ years of relevant legal experience, including substantial commercial contracting experience; a combination of law firm and in-house experience is preferred.
  • Demonstrated ability to independently draft and negotiate sophisticated B2B commercial agreements.
  • Strong working knowledge of SaaS, technology, privacy and data protection issues. Experience with marketplaces, payments, gift cards, rewards, loyalty programs, channel partnerships or retail relationships is particularly valuable.
  • Excellent judgment and the ability to identify the issues that matter, propose workable solutions and escalate appropriately.
  • Ability to manage a high volume of matters, prioritize effectively and deliver high-quality work in a fast-moving environment.
  • Clear, concise and adaptable written and verbal communication skills, including the ability to explain legal issues to non-lawyers.
  • A collaborative, low-ego approach and a willingness to be hands-on across both strategic and day-to-day matters.
  • Comfort operating with autonomy while keeping the General Counsel and key stakeholders appropriately informed.
